Updated GDB build

This commit is contained in:
Niklaus Schiess 2021-04-16 16:03:16 +02:00
parent edcac69d3f
commit 17c9e910c8

View file

@ -53,9 +53,26 @@ jobs:
- name: Install dependencies - name: Install dependencies
run: sudo apk update && sudo apk add bash && sudo bash build/install_deps_alpine.sh run: sudo apk update && sudo apk add bash && sudo bash build/install_deps_alpine.sh
- name: Install build compiler
run: /bin/sh -c "cd / && curl -so ${ARCH}-cross.tgz ${HOST}/${ARCH}-cross.tgz && tar -xf ${ARCH}-cross.tgz && rm ${ARCH}-cross.tgz && cd ${ARCH}-cross"
env:
ARCH: x86_64-linux-musl
HOST: http://musl.cc/
TEMP: /tmp
USER: 0
- name: Install dependencies workaround
run: /bin/sh -c "cd / && curl -so ${ARCH}-cross.tgz ${HOST}/${ARCH}-cross.tgz && tar -xf ${ARCH}-cross.tgz && rm ${ARCH}-cross.tgz && cd ${ARCH}-cross"
env:
ARCH: x86_64-linux-musl
HOST: http://musl.cc/
TEMP: /tmp
USER: 0
- name: Build GDB - name: Build GDB
id: build_gdb id: build_gdb
run: | run: |
export PATH="$PATH:/x86_64-linux-musl-cross/bin"
$GITHUB_WORKSPACE/build/targets/build_gdb.sh x86_64 $GITHUB_WORKSPACE/build/targets/build_gdb.sh x86_64
- name: Upload artifacts - name: Upload artifacts